Caravelas

A sleepy little beach town. Few tourists come here so there aren’t the quantity of bars and curio shops we have seen in the other towns. It’s mostly Fishermen, biologists and locals who have many generations here.




We came upon a festival, with lantern decorations and people playing music in the streets.

Black Magdalene

Black Magdalene have a bass and guitar player, a drummer, and three belly dancers. They also have a sexy vocalist and decorate their mic stand with swag. Combining world music with electronics and live instrumentation they put on a special show.

They call themselves organic dark wave with middle eastern sounds. They have a bandcamp page where you can listen but of course, the fun is in seeing the band play and dance live!
